强力推荐:IntelliJ Thrift插件 - 卓越的Thrift语言支持工具

强力推荐:IntelliJ Thrift插件 - 卓越的Thrift语言支持工具

intellij-thriftIntelliJ IDEA Thrift plugin for Youzan nova protocol项目地址:https://gitcode.com/gh_mirrors/in/intellij-thrift

在现代软件开发领域,高效而灵活的通信协议是连接服务的核心。Thrift,作为Apache基金会的一员,以其轻量级、高性能和跨平台特性备受青睐。为了使开发者在强大的IntelliJ IDEA环境中更加便捷地编写和管理Thrift文件,我们有缘邂逅了【intellij-thrift】——一个专为提升Thrift语言在IntelliJ IDEA中支持度而生的开源插件。

项目介绍

IntelliJ Thrift,一款源自[fkorotkov/intellij-thrift]的增强型插件,其核心价值在于为广大的Java与多语言开发者提供了一站式的Thrift文件编辑解决方案。此项目特别添加了对自定义命名空间“nova”的识别功能,使得特定场景下的代码管理和协作变得更加流畅。

技术分析

  • 环境兼容性:该插件基于IntelliJ IDEA社区版进行构建,确保了广泛的兼容性和易获取性。
  • 构建指南:通过简单的步骤(清理输出目录,重建项目,打包插件),开发者可以轻松获得或构建自己的插件版本,提升了自定义部署的可能性。
  • 系统要求:针对至少2016.1版本的IntelliJ IDEA设计,保证了与现代化开发工具栈的无缝对接。

应用场景

  • 微服务架构:在使用Thrift作为服务间通讯协议的微服务项目中,此插件能显著提高开发效率,减少语法错误和配置疏漏。
  • 跨语言开发:对于同时涉及Java、Python、C++等多语言开发的团队,统一的IDE支持减少了学习成本,促进了代码的一致性。
  • 教育与培训:教学环境下,简化Thrift的学习曲线,帮助学生快速掌握Thrift规范编写。

项目特点

  1. 定制化支持:独特的自定义命名空间处理,满足特定项目需求,如企业内部标准命名实践。
  2. 一体化编辑体验:在熟悉的IntelliJ IDEA界面中享受智能提示、语法高亮、错误检测等高级编辑功能,提升编码质量。
  3. 易于安装与升级:简单几步即可完成插件的本地安装,跟随官方IntelliJ IDEA更新步伐,保证开发环境的持续适配。
  4. 开放源码社区:依托于GitHub,开发者可以参与贡献,定制个性化的扩展功能,形成良好的技术支持和反馈循环。

综上所述,IntelliJ Thrift不仅是Thrift爱好者的得力助手,更是专业开发团队提高生产率的秘密武器。无论是新手入门还是老手进阶,这个插件都值得您一试,开启高效、愉快的Thrift编程之旅!立即下载IntelliJ IDEA并安装此插件,让您的编码之路更加顺畅。🌟

intellij-thriftIntelliJ IDEA Thrift plugin for Youzan nova protocol项目地址:https://gitcode.com/gh_mirrors/in/intellij-thrift

  • 18
    点赞
  • 14
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

马兰菲

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值